## Tuning

Bramblegate ships with conservative rollout defaults — slow ramps, generous bake times. That's on purpose: a flag that ramps too fast can page half the org before anyone notices the metrics dip. If you're tempted to speed things up, measure first. Most of these knobs interact; shrinking the bake window without also tightening the error threshold basically disables the auto-halt logic. Change one thing at a time and watch the dashboards. The current defaults are listed here.

constants for bagag-fawip:
BUDGETS = {
    "wenius": 400,
    "brieth": 224,
    "rusath": 783,
    "eliys": 187,
    "aldax": 737,
    "ralion": 818,
    "istius": 153,
}

## Step 4: Point devices at the beta channel

Welcome aboard! Before Flintbeam devices can pull firmware from the beta channel, you'll update the rollout config in `deploy/firmware.env`. Set `FW_CHANNEL=beta` and `FW_ROLLOUT_PERCENT=10` — we always start small, ask Marguerite why sometime (it involves 400 bricked thermostats). The updater also needs the channel signing credential so devices can verify payloads before flashing. Add the following line directly below the channel settings.

env line for bagap-yajep: COURIER_KEY20=b4db4e5e33a646898766

Dependency pinning for the Larkspan build system: all direct dependencies must be pinned to exact versions; transitive pins are generated weekly by the lockfile refresh job. Reviewers should reject any change that introduces a range specifier or removes a pin without a linked upgrade ticket. Security patches may bypass the weekly cycle but still require exact pins. If the refresh job fails, rerun it locally before approving anything. The job reads its pinning rules from the configuration that follows.

deployment values, yajep-kajop:
[praael]
host = praael.tolvaqworks.corp
user = praael_svc
database = praael_prod

- [ ] **Step 7: Breaker override escrow.** After sealing the signing keys for the Tallgrove upstream API circuit breaker, confirm the support team can force the breaker open during a full outage. The override bundle lives in the sealed escrow drawer and is useless without its unlock phrase. Two ceremony witnesses must initial this step before proceeding. The escrow bundle is decrypted with the recovery passphrase that follows.

vault phrase of kahip-kahop = holath-quenmir